Another post from Mike! Ever want to share a new CD a photo album or a short movie to friends but you couldn’t find an easy way to transfer the file? Sometimes sending files takes too long pending the size and sometimes the recipient is not around to accept or does not have auto accept setup with their instant messaging client. If this sounds like you, here is your solution.

For the past two years I have been using YouSendIt. I use it as a means to send my friends music. We will just go ahead and skip around the ethics and legality behind sending your friends music online, but this service is seriously easy for anyone to use. Simply zip a folder into a single file, log onto YouSendIt, upload the file and you get a link a few moments later that you can email your friends or copy and paste to them allowing them to download whatever content you uploaded. The free service is pretty standard allowing 100 downloads or a 7 day window for downloading.

I like yousend it for a few simple reasons.

  1. Its clean and easy to use, signing up is simple and free ( I used my 2nd junk email account to activate the link)
  2. Its easy for people to figure out how to download the file, other competitors make downloading the link hard in order to keep the user on their website longer, allowing more money to be made off advertising.
  3. I haven’t found anything better yet.

There are some competitors that promise the same results but I haven’t had a clean user experience, think turboupload.com, filefactory, megaupload.com.
